Sharon Bell, a 69-year-old woman from Aurora, Illinois, was found dead on December 22, 2020, in what authorities determined to be an apparent murder-suicide. The incident took place in the 1800 block of Sapphire Lane, where police were called to perform a welfare check after neighbors noticed newspapers piling up outside the home. Upon entering the residence, officers discovered the bodies of Sharon Bell and her husband, 67-year-old Lee Bell, both of whom had sustained fatal gunshot wounds.
